iOS - 使用同一个应用程序在特定设备组之间共享数据(以及数据更新)

时间:2015-08-07 19:53:20

标签: ios ios8 nsuserdefaults keychain ios8-share-extension

举一个简单的例子,如果一个应用程序可以显示照片而另一个人拍摄一张新照片,那么拥有相同应用程序的其他人在同一组中(如果可以这样分组)可以事先创建,将获得新照片的更新 - (照片列表将更改,应用程序将相应地处理)(并通过推送通知或其他一些自动更新'进行更新)。这对于编辑照片并更新照片以及其他人进行更新也很有用。

我想知道有哪些选项(目前仅限iOS 8+解决方案):

  1. 有人下载应用程序并且"邀请"其他人也下载了应用程序以成为他们小组的一部分 - 这样他们就可以按照我所描述的方式接收应用程序的任何添加或更新。我真的不想要知道其他人的电子邮件地址。寻找另一种选择。

  2. 在群组成员之间共享此数据(此解决方案可能取决于#1,我不确定)。

  3. 我在这里已经阅读了像NSUserDefaults或密钥链分组这样的解决方案,但由于我们在这里谈论图像并且依赖于#1,可能还有其他更好的解决方案。

0 个答案:

没有答案